One of the primary factors driving market growth is the widespread recognition of sulfur deficiency in agricultural soils worldwide. Historically, sulfur availability was sustained through atmospheric deposition linked to industrial emissions. However, stricter environmental regulations and the adoption of cleaner technologies have significantly reduced sulfur emissions, thereby diminishing natural sulfur inputs to the soil. As a result, sulfur deficiency has emerged as a limiting factor affecting crop yields and quality, creating a strong demand for sulfur-containing fertilizers such as ATS. By replenishing soil sulfur levels effectively, ATS addresses this critical nutrient gap, supporting healthier crop development.
Concurrently, the intensification of agriculture to meet the nutritional needs of a growing global population has increased the demand for efficient and balanced fertilization strategies. High-intensity cropping systems often lead to rapid depletion of soil nutrients, necessitating fertilizers capable of delivering multiple essential nutrients simultaneously. ATS meets this requirement by supplying nitrogen and sulfur in a readily soluble and plant-available form, which enhances nutrient use efficiency. This attribute is particularly advantageous in precision agriculture, where targeted nutrient application is essential for maximizing yields while minimizing environmental impact.
Technological Innovations and Market Opportunities
Technological advancements have further expanded the utility of ammonium thiosulfate in modern agronomy. Innovations such as foliar sprays and fertigation systems enable more precise and timely delivery of nutrients, increasing the effectiveness of ATS applications. These technologies contribute to sustainable farming practices by reducing nutrient losses through volatilization and leaching, thereby improving overall nutrient management. Additionally, ATSโs compatibility with other agrochemicals facilitates integrated nutrient and pest management approaches, enhancing its appeal to farmers seeking comprehensive crop input solutions.
